peat metagenome

Peat permafrost microbial communities from Stordalen Mire near Abisko, Sweden - II_Palsa_N2_1 metagenome

Peat permafrost microbial communities from Stordalen Mire; palsa peat incubated with plant litter for 18 days, no enrichment
